2013 SCR to NGN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2013

During 2013, the SCR to NGN ex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on March 21, valuing the pair at 13.6816.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 1, dropping to 11.8807.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 1.8010 NGN.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 12.0461 to the December average rate of 13.1950, the exchange rate registered a net change of 9.54%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2013 high of 13.6816 was up 11.86% compared to the 2012 peak of 12.2312,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 12.2958 11.8807 12.0461
February 12.8441 12.2976 12.4775
March 13.6816 12.7770 13.3758
April 13.5808 13.4400 13.5048
May 13.5075 13.2856 13.4148
June 13.6626 13.3752 13.5159
July 13.6264 13.3303 13.4506
August 13.5990 13.2941 13.4131
September 13.6487 13.2583 13.4572
October 13.3868 13.1382 13.2651
November 13.2560 13.0084 13.1695
December 13.3466 13.0555 13.1950
